About The
Artist |
|
Artist Fi
Channon presents a series of works whose
emphasis is on our connection with the Spiritual
world. These inspirational paintings bring forth
the unknown, the unconscious and divine;
displaying how multi-layered our existence is.
|
|
As an
artist, Fiona has over 10 years experience,
having previously worked as a graphic designer.
During her time living in Greece she has evolved
her own powerful style which has resulted in the
current series of paintings. Many people have
commissioned works, notably portraits, and this
has inspired Fi to experiment further. She
brings fresh ideas and powerful, sensitive
images to the viewer's eyes and senses with her
innovative approach. |
|
 |
|
Now
living back in England with her family, Fi is
continuing her career, all the time furthering
the depth of her work and producing the art we
see today. Since coming to England, Fi has met
fellow artist Alan Brain and together they
presented a successful exhibition in the
beautiful setting of Wellington College in
Crowthorne, Berks in Autumn 2006. The aim of the
exhibition was to create a holistic experience
of sight and sound therefore making it a more
than just an exhibition. |
